近些碰到一个业务需要处理结果集,因此需要使用游标.用于统计策略的流量值.直接上栗子说明游标用法.

先看strategy表中数据


一共10条.

通过游标遍历统计流量

CREATE DEFINER=`root`@`localhost` PROCEDURE `sum_interface_traffic`()BEGINdeclare sum_in_traffic float;declare sum_out_traffic float;declare strategy_id int;declare app_ids varchar(300);declare done INT default 0;#涉及到主键,必须用别名,否则fetch不到值declare cur cursor for select s.id, s.app_ids from strategy s;DECLARE CONTINUE HANDLER FOR NOT FOUND SET done = TRUE;/** 要是需要频繁的调用该存储过程,可以将 drop temporary table if exists sum_strategy_interface_traffic;注释 改为truncate table sum_strategy_interface_traffic;避免临时表的频繁创建**/drop temporary table if exists sum_strategy_interface_traffic;create temporary table sum_strategy_interface_traffic(strategy_id int unsigned,sum_in_traffic float unsigned,sum_out_traffic float unsigned)default charset utf8 collate utf8_general_ci engine InnoDB;open cur;#打开游标re:repeat    FETCH cur INTO strategy_id, app_ids;    ##结束循环    if done then      leave re;end if;    call split(app_ids);    select sum(sit.sum_in_traffic) from sum_interface_traffic_by_app_id sit where sit.app_id in (select * from tmp_strs) into sum_in_traffic;    select sum(sit.sum_out_traffic) from sum_interface_traffic_by_app_id sit where sit.app_id in (select * from tmp_strs) into sum_out_traffic;    insert into sum_strategy_interface_traffic values(strategy_id,sum_in_traffic,sum_out_traffic);until done end repeat; close cur;#关闭游标END

运行结果;


PS:在开发种会碰到遍历结果集提前退出的场景,比如

有些存储过程要是涉及select XXX into .. (其中XXX涉及到数据库的查询,哪怕是调用其他的存储过程或者函数),要是碰到查询为空的情况会导致循环退出

在上面例子上稍稍修改说明:

CREATE DEFINER=`root`@`localhost` PROCEDURE `sum_interface_traffic`()BEGINdeclare sum_in_traffic float;declare sum_out_traffic float;declare strategy_id int;declare app_ids varchar(300);declare done INT default 0;declare test varchar(15);  #涉及到主键,必须用别名,否则fetch不到值declare cur cursor for select s.id, s.app_ids from strategy s;DECLARE CONTINUE HANDLER FOR NOT FOUND SET done = TRUE;/** 要是需要频繁的调用该存储过程,可以将 drop temporary table if exists sum_strategy_interface_traffic;注释 改为truncate table sum_strategy_interface_traffic;避免临时表的频繁创建**/drop temporary table if exists sum_strategy_interface_traffic;create temporary table sum_strategy_interface_traffic(strategy_id int unsigned,sum_in_traffic float unsigned,sum_out_traffic float unsigned)default charset utf8 collate utf8_general_ci engine InnoDB;open cur;#打开游标re:repeat    FETCH cur INTO strategy_id, app_ids;    ##结束循环    if done then      leave re;end if;    call split(app_ids);    select sum(sit.sum_in_traffic) from sum_interface_traffic_by_app_id sit where sit.app_id in (select * from tmp_strs) into sum_in_traffic;    select sum(sit.sum_out_traffic) from sum_interface_traffic_by_app_id sit where sit.app_id in (select * from tmp_strs) into sum_out_traffic;    insert into sum_strategy_interface_traffic values(strategy_id,sum_in_traffic,sum_out_traffic);    /***仅仅演示游标提前退出    当查询到第7条数据的时候,app_ids字符串为null,所以临时表tmp_strs是为空    select * from tmp_strs limit 1 into test;导致循环提前退出    **/    select * from tmp_strs limit 1 into test;until done end repeat; close cur;#关闭游标END
看效果;

只有7条数据.

解决办法,我在一篇技术博客看到有人提供了三种解决方案.我这只提供其中一种简单明了的:

在select * from tmp_strs limit 1 into test;后面添加处理逻辑

部分代码如下

/***仅仅演示游标提前退出    当查询到第7条数据的时候,app_ids字符串为null,所以临时表tmp_strs是为空    select * from tmp_strs limit 1 into test;导致循环提前退出**/select * from tmp_strs limit 1 into test; ##防止循环提前结束 set done = 0;
